You can't pick up a newspaper or listen to the news these days without hearing about another data breach or cyber fraud. Whether you are a person, a company-or even the U.S. Government-nobody seems immune to the threat of cyber attacks. While these attacks are difficult to identify or defend, there are steps that all company boards and management teams should be taking to mitigate their risk.

Host Kerstetter taps PwC's cyber expert Charles Beard to outline a 6-step program that boards can use to oversee cyber risk. They then discuss the most important questions boards should be asking their managements and IT staff to insure that all safeguards have been implemented.
